Had this same problem when we upgraded the jenkins gitlab plugin to the latest version. If it's the same cause, basically you have to configure your jenkins job, in the built-triggers section where the gitlab plugin settings are, you want to set the 'Rebuild Open Merge Requests' dropdown to something other than 'Never'.

If I create a new merge request a jenkins build is triggered. However, when I update a MR, no build is triggered.

Under Services -> Jenkins CI, I have "Merge Request events" checked. The description says "This url will be triggered when a merge request is created/updated/merge".

However the Jenkins CI documentation says "Trigger a Jenkins build after push to a repository and/or when a merge request is created" http://doc.gitlab.com/ee/integration/jenkins.html

Is the Jenkins CI service suppose to trigger a jenkins build when a MR is updated?
